commit 6defe42c31b18ad8dbb2fff3869b0fccbd821e97
Author: Richard Hughes <richard hughsie com>
Date: Fri Sep 21 11:56:53 2012 +0100
power and media-keys: Use logind for suspending and rebooting the system
Use the new logind features to suspend and resume but making sure we opt out
of logind handling the sleep and power keys, and also inhibiting for lid close
auto-suspend if there is an external monitor connected.
Also use a delay inihibit for logind so that we can do actions on suspend like
blanking the screen using the screensaver and also poking the screensaver on
resume.
https://bugzilla.gnome.org/show_bug.cgi?id=680689
